Title: Manami Ota: Innovator in Cutting and Sewing Technologies
Introduction
Manami Ota is a prominent inventor based in Nagoya, Japan. She has made significant contributions to the fields of cutting and sewing technologies. With a total of 4 patents to her name, Ota has demonstrated her innovative spirit and technical expertise.
Latest Patents
Ota's latest patents include a cutting apparatus and a multi-needle sewing machine. The cutting apparatus features a storing unit that holds data of patterns with various colors or designs. It includes a display unit and a control device that can change the color or design of a pattern based on the workpiece's specifications. The multi-needle sewing machine is designed with multiple needle bars and a projector that can project images onto the workpiece cloth, enhancing the embroidery process.
